DmC Definitive Edition Gets New Screens and Info

January 30, 2015 by Stephen Daly

Hardcore and Turbo modes will pose most players a big challenge.

New screens from DmC Definitive Edition have been revealed thanks to a preview on the PlayStation Blog and you can check them out in the gallery below. 

During a preview event, Sony's Ryan Clements wrote "It’s an enhanced version of the original PS3 game with a slew of new features and a layer of polish that makes Dante’s demon-killing exploits and confident gunplay even more satisfying. I had a chance to put the Definitive Edition through its paces, and managed to avoid embarrassing myself in the Bloody Palace along the way."

Coming in at 60fps and 1080p, the new version boasts Turbo Mode, which increases the game's speed 20 per cent, and adds a 'Gods Must Die' difficulty level. All enemies have the devil triggers active when they spawn in this mode, and Clements commented that "This is the game’s way of saying 'good luck, LOL,' and then throwing Dante into a giant hell blender." 

A Hardcore Mode also introduces a more traditional Devil May Cry-style combat design and S-ranking system. A new Bloody Palace arean for the Vergil's Downfall DLC has also been added.
